Output 183fe92f0426c6cababe7af94db7601aa6e23d2a4491d20335c060a04f3c967e:0

value
523229618
script pubkey
OP_0 OP_PUSHBYTES_20 5aa5fec83f058dde43dcef0b7635edc5019b939e
address
ltc1qt2jlajplqkxaus7uau9hvd0dc5qehyu76sjjkz
transaction
183fe92f0426c6cababe7af94db7601aa6e23d2a4491d20335c060a04f3c967e
spent
true